Seneca gave up the first goal on Thursday, but they didn't let that get them down. While the 3-3 score might suggest a draw, it was the Bobcats who were credited with the win. The Seneca Bobcats got it done in the shootout by posting four goals to the Walhalla Razorbacks's two. This was a revenge game for Seneca: when they faced off against Walhalla back in February, they had to take a 5-1 defeat.
Seneca's victory bumped their record up to 5-6-1. As for Walhalla, their loss ended a five-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 8-3.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Seneca will head out to challenge Pickens at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Seneca are facing Pickens at the right time seeing as Pickens are stuck on a four-game losing streak. As for Walhalla, they will venture away from home to face off against Belton-Honea Path at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Walhalla will be up against Belton-Honea Path's rather soft defense (which has allowed four goals per match), so fans could be in store for a big offensive performance.
